Ed
há 10 meses
Para responder à pergunta sobre o principal desafio ao implementar a programação dinâmica, vamos analisar cada uma das alternativas: A) Definir o problema de forma correta - Isso é fundamental, pois a programação dinâmica depende de uma boa definição do problema para identificar subproblemas. B) Escolher o algoritmo de resolução correto - Embora importante, isso geralmente é uma consequência de uma boa definição do problema. C) Implementar a recursividade corretamente - A recursividade é uma parte da programação dinâmica, mas o foco principal é na definição e na estruturação do problema. D) Gerenciar a memória de forma eficiente - Isso é relevante, mas não é o principal desafio. E) Todas as opções acima - Essa opção sugere que todos os desafios mencionados são igualmente importantes. Dentre as opções, a definição correta do problema é o primeiro e mais crucial passo na programação dinâmica, pois sem isso, as outras etapas se tornam irrelevantes. Portanto, a alternativa correta é: A) Definir o problema de forma correta.
Já tem uma conta?
Ao continuar, você aceita os Termos de Uso e Política de Privacidade
Mais perguntas desse material